Voorhees University is proud to announce a generous donation from Dr. Scott and Laura Stevens to support the 10 White Coat Scholars Initiative housed within the Center of Excellence for Research and Program Innovation (CERPI).
This transformative gift will directly support Voorhees University students who are aspiring to enter the medical profession through the university’s highly regarded 10 White Coat Scholars Initiative. The program is designed to provide academic, career, and research opportunities to high-achieving, goal-oriented students committed to entering the healthcare field, particularly medicine.
“This extraordinary gift from Dr. and Mrs. Stevens is a strong endorsement of our vision to increase representation in medicine and improve health equity,” said Dr. Zhabiz Golkar, Endowed Professor, founder of the 10 White Coat Scholars Initiative and Director of CERPI. “Their support is helping us build a pipeline of academically excellent, service-minded students who are prepared to lead and transform healthcare systems across the
nation.”
Dr. Scott Stevens is a board-certified orthopedic surgeon fellowship-trained in sports medicine. Since 1999, he has served patients in Mankato, Minnesota, and surrounding areas through the Orthopaedic & Fracture Clinic. With a specialization in minimally invasive joint repair, sports medicine, and orthopedic trauma care, Dr. Stevens is committed to ensuring the next generation of healthcare professionals receive the opportunities and mentorship needed to thrive.
The 10 White Coat Scholars Initiative emphasizes a multi-step pathway to medical school success, including shadowing at national and international healthcare institutions, research internships, public relations engagement with medical schools, and preparation for critical exams such as the MCAT and DAT. The initiative cultivates core competencies such as creativity, professionalism, teamwork, and academic excellence (GPA 3.5+), aiming to enhance both student readiness and post-graduation visibility.
